Reciprocity Collective is a 501(c)(3) organization based in Denver, Colorado, registered in 2017, with $486,440 in FY2024 revenue. CharityIndex grades it B.

How the rating works →Measures how much of every dollar spent actually reaches programs, plus what it costs to raise $100 of donations. The worse of the two measures sets the letter (85%+ to programs is an A; under $15 to raise $100 is an A), averaged over the three most recent filings. Not scored for Reciprocity Collective— this filing type doesn't report it, and the rating simply skips it (never counts it against the organization). See the exact thresholds →
Measures whether the organization is built to last: how many months its reserves would cover expenses (3+ months earns an A-range score, but hoarding 5+ years of budget is capped) and whether it runs a surplus or a deficit. For Reciprocity Collective: 5 mo reserves · +22% margin earns a A on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
Checks how the organization is run, from its own Form 990: an independent board majority, a board of five or more, conflict-of-interest, whistleblower and document-retention policies, and independently audited financials. The share of disclosed checks that pass sets the letter. Not scored for Reciprocity Collective— this filing type doesn't report it, and the rating simply skips it (never counts it against the organization). See the exact thresholds →
Counts five disclosure signals: a recent filing, a mission statement, program descriptions, a listed website, and the full expense breakdown. More disclosure, better letter. For Reciprocity Collective: 2 of 5 disclosure signals earns a C on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
